Abstract
Sheet surfaces are commonly used in design to represent thin-walled surface s. A method of manufacturing these surfaces via layered manufacturing (LM) using local wall thickening is presented. By considering the accuracy of on ly one side of the surface important, the need for support structured can b e removed by thickened regions on the unimportant side. This preserves the accuracy of the accurate side while reducing the total material used and bu ild time during manufacture. A method of selecting an orientation to maximi ze the accuracy of the important side while minimizing the amount of wall t hickening is presented. Also, algorithms for locally thickening the surface and generating slices for manufacturing on a LM machine are developed. Fin ally, several examples are manufactured using the proposed method to compar e material and build time savings over conventional support methods. (C) 20 00 Elsevier Science Ltd.
